In the movie Nobel Son, Barkley Michaelson, a gifted yet underachieving college student, becomes the subject of a kidnapping orchestrated by Thaddeus James. Thaddeus, a brilliant but vengeful young man, claims to be Barkley's illegitimate half-brother. The abduction occurs shortly after Barkley's father, Eli Michaelson, wins the Nobel Prize for chemistry, which further adds to the turmoil surrounding the family.

Thaddeus harbors deep animosity towards their father, seeing him as an egotistical and arrogant man who neglected his personal life in pursuit of his scientific career. Seeking revenge and motivated by a desire to tarnish their father's reputation, Thaddeus convinces Barkley to join forces with him in a high-stakes extortion plot against Eli Michaelson.

The plot revolves around an audacious demand for a multimillion-dollar ransom, which Barkley and Thaddeus plan to extract from their father. As the story progresses, a web of intrigue and deception unfolds, with unexpected twists and turns.

Throughout the movie, the complex dynamics within the Michaelson family are explored. Barkley's mother, Sarah, is caught in the crossfire, torn between loyalty towards her husband and concern for her son's well-being. Additionally, Barkley's girlfriend, City Hall, becomes entangled in the scheme, adding another layer to the already intricate plot.

As Barkley and Thaddeus execute their plan, emotions run high, and the movie delves into themes of familial dysfunction, ego, and the pursuit of recognition. The narrative takes viewers on a suspenseful journey, posing questions about loyalty, betrayal, and the lengths individuals are willing to go in seeking justice or revenge.

Without revealing the complete plot or its climax, Nobel Son is a thrilling crime drama that explores the complex dynamics of a family fractured by ambition, envy, and the consequences of their actions.
